Overview
The multi-axis CNC riveting machine is a highly specialized piece of equipment used in modern manufacturing. It leverages computer numerical control (CNC) technology to perform precise riveting operations across multiple axes, ensuring consistent quality and efficiency. This machine is particularly valuable in industries where high precision and repeatability are critical, such as automotive and aerospace manufacturing. Unlike traditional riveting tools, the multi-axis CNC riveting machine offers programmable control, allowing for complex riveting patterns and adjustments on the fly. This adaptability makes it suitable for a wide range of applications, from assembling small electronic components to large structural parts in aircraft.
Structure and Working Principle
The multi-axis CNC riveting machine consists of several key components, including a robust frame, servo motors, a control panel, and multiple riveting heads. The frame provides stability and support, while the servo motors ensure precise movement along each axis. The control panel houses the CNC system, which interprets programming instructions and coordinates the machine's movements. During operation, the machine follows pre-programmed paths to position the riveting heads accurately. The riveting heads apply force to insert and deform rivets, creating strong, permanent joints. The multi-axis capability allows the machine to access hard-to-reach areas and perform intricate riveting patterns, significantly enhancing its versatility.
Key Features
One of the standout features of the multi-axis CNC riveting machine is its ability to operate along multiple axes, typically ranging from 3 to 6 axes. This multi-axis functionality enables the machine to perform complex riveting tasks with high precision. Additionally, the machine's CNC system allows for easy programming and adjustments, reducing setup times and increasing productivity. Other notable features include high-speed riveting capabilities, compatibility with various rivet types and sizes, and advanced sensors for quality control. These features collectively ensure that the machine delivers consistent, high-quality results while minimizing material waste and downtime.
Application Areas
The multi-axis CNC riveting machine is widely used in industries that demand precision and efficiency. In the automotive sector, it is employed to assemble body panels, chassis components, and interior parts. The aerospace industry relies on these machines for assembling aircraft fuselages, wings, and other critical structures. The electronics industry also benefits from the machine's precision, using it to assemble small components in devices such as smartphones and laptops. Additionally, the machine is used in the production of household appliances, industrial equipment, and even some medical devices.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and performance of a multi-axis CNC riveting machine. Key maintenance tasks include lubricating moving parts, checking for wear and tear, and calibrating the CNC system. It is also important to inspect the riveting heads and replace them as needed to maintain consistent quality. Operators should be properly trained to handle the machine safely and efficiently. Safety precautions include wearing protective gear, ensuring the work area is clear of obstructions, and following the manufacturer's guidelines for operation and maintenance.
B2B Procurement Guide
When purchasing a multi-axis CNC riveting machine, it is crucial to consider several factors to ensure it meets your production needs. First, evaluate the number of axes required for your specific applications. More axes provide greater flexibility but may increase costs. Next, consider the machine's riveting speed and precision, as these will directly impact productivity and product quality. It is also important to assess the machine's compatibility with your existing production line and the types of rivets you use. Additionally, look for machines with advanced features such as automated quality control and user-friendly programming interfaces. Finally, consider the manufacturer's reputation, warranty, and after-sales support to ensure long-term reliability.
